Nettiers.AdventureWorks.Entities.VIndividualDemographicsBase.GetPropertyValueByName C# (CSharp) Method

GetPropertyValueByName() public static method

Gets the property value by name.
public static GetPropertyValueByName ( VIndividualDemographics entity, string propertyName ) : object
entity VIndividualDemographics The entity.
propertyName string Name of the property.
return object
		public static object GetPropertyValueByName(VIndividualDemographics entity, string propertyName)
		{
			switch (propertyName)
			{
				case "CustomerId":
					return entity.CustomerId;
				case "TotalPurchaseYtd":
					return entity.TotalPurchaseYtd;
				case "DateFirstPurchase":
					return entity.DateFirstPurchase;
				case "BirthDate":
					return entity.BirthDate;
				case "MaritalStatus":
					return entity.MaritalStatus;
				case "YearlyIncome":
					return entity.YearlyIncome;
				case "Gender":
					return entity.Gender;
				case "TotalChildren":
					return entity.TotalChildren;
				case "NumberChildrenAtHome":
					return entity.NumberChildrenAtHome;
				case "Education":
					return entity.Education;
				case "Occupation":
					return entity.Occupation;
				case "HomeOwnerFlag":
					return entity.HomeOwnerFlag;
				case "NumberCarsOwned":
					return entity.NumberCarsOwned;
			}
			return null;
		}
				

Same methods

VIndividualDemographicsBase::GetPropertyValueByName ( string propertyName ) : object